Transaction 75551f7103157b69bb783abcacf2a6ef5550f9300d56d8cfbec6bde3f09f960b

1 Input
2 Outputs
  • 75551f7103157b69bb783abcacf2a6ef5550f9300d56d8cfbec6bde3f09f960b:0
  • value  13598025
    address  3GTTDkr838FG21a34gdAAUYAjaANZEH9m9
  • 75551f7103157b69bb783abcacf2a6ef5550f9300d56d8cfbec6bde3f09f960b:1
  • value  33686959
    address  3HmhUWNJXSiPyyhNy8SQmhdTNTdQpgnQUw